Index

B C D E F G H I L P R S T V 
All Classes and Interfaces|All Packages|Constant Field Values

B

beginCreateTable(ConnectorSession, ConnectorTableMetadata, Optional<ConnectorTableLayout>, RetryMode)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
beginInsert(ConnectorSession, ConnectorTableHandle, List<ColumnHandle>, RetryMode)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
beginMerge(ConnectorSession, ConnectorTableHandle, RetryMode)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
beginStatisticsCollection(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
beginTransaction(IsolationLevel, boolean, boolean) -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
BlackHoleColumnHandle - Class in io.trino.plugin.blackhole
 
BlackHoleColumnHandle(ColumnMetadata) - Constructor for class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
BlackHoleColumnHandle(String, Type) - Constructor for class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
BlackHoleConnector - Class in io.trino.plugin.blackhole
 
BlackHoleConnector(BlackHoleMetadata, BlackHoleSplitManager, BlackHolePageSourceProvider, BlackHolePageSinkProvider, BlackHoleNodePartitioningProvider, TypeManager, ExecutorService) - Constructor for class io.trino.plugin.blackhole.BlackHoleConnector
 
BlackHoleConnectorFactory - Class in io.trino.plugin.blackhole
 
BlackHoleConnectorFactory() - Constructor for class io.trino.plugin.blackhole.BlackHoleConnectorFactory
 
BlackHoleInsertTableHandle - Class in io.trino.plugin.blackhole
 
BlackHoleInsertTableHandle(Duration) - Constructor for class io.trino.plugin.blackhole.BlackHoleInsertTableHandle
 
BlackHoleMergeSink - Class in io.trino.plugin.blackhole
 
BlackHoleMergeSink() - Constructor for class io.trino.plugin.blackhole.BlackHoleMergeSink
 
BlackHoleMergeTableHandle - Class in io.trino.plugin.blackhole
 
BlackHoleMergeTableHandle(BlackHoleTableHandle) - Constructor for class io.trino.plugin.blackhole.BlackHoleMergeTableHandle
 
BlackHoleMetadata - Class in io.trino.plugin.blackhole
 
BlackHoleMetadata() - Constructor for class io.trino.plugin.blackhole.BlackHoleMetadata
 
BlackHoleNodePartitioningProvider - Class in io.trino.plugin.blackhole
 
BlackHoleNodePartitioningProvider(TypeOperators) - Constructor for class io.trino.plugin.blackhole.BlackHoleNodePartitioningProvider
 
BlackHoleOutputTableHandle - Class in io.trino.plugin.blackhole
 
BlackHoleOutputTableHandle(BlackHoleTableHandle, Duration) - Constructor for class io.trino.plugin.blackhole.BlackHoleOutputTableHandle
 
BlackHolePageSinkProvider - Class in io.trino.plugin.blackhole
 
BlackHolePageSinkProvider(ListeningScheduledExecutorService) - Constructor for class io.trino.plugin.blackhole.BlackHolePageSinkProvider
 
BlackHolePageSourceProvider - Class in io.trino.plugin.blackhole
 
BlackHolePageSourceProvider(ListeningScheduledExecutorService) - Constructor for class io.trino.plugin.blackhole.BlackHolePageSourceProvider
 
BlackHolePartitioningHandle - Enum Class in io.trino.plugin.blackhole
 
BlackHolePlugin - Class in io.trino.plugin.blackhole
 
BlackHolePlugin() - Constructor for class io.trino.plugin.blackhole.BlackHolePlugin
 
BlackHoleSplit - Enum Class in io.trino.plugin.blackhole
 
BlackHoleSplitManager - Class in io.trino.plugin.blackhole
 
BlackHoleSplitManager() - Constructor for class io.trino.plugin.blackhole.BlackHoleSplitManager
 
BlackHoleTableHandle - Class in io.trino.plugin.blackhole
 
BlackHoleTableHandle(ConnectorTableMetadata, int, int, int, int, Duration) - Constructor for class io.trino.plugin.blackhole.BlackHoleTableHandle
 
BlackHoleTableHandle(String, String, List<BlackHoleColumnHandle>, int, int, int, int, Duration) - Constructor for class io.trino.plugin.blackhole.BlackHoleTableHandle
 
BlackHoleTransactionHandle - Enum Class in io.trino.plugin.blackhole
 

C

create(String, Map<String, String>, ConnectorContext) - Method in class io.trino.plugin.blackhole.BlackHoleConnectorFactory
 
createMergeSink(ConnectorTransactionHandle, ConnectorSession, ConnectorMergeTableHandle, ConnectorPageSinkId) - Method in class io.trino.plugin.blackhole.BlackHolePageSinkProvider
 
createPageSink(ConnectorTransactionHandle, ConnectorSession, ConnectorInsertTableHandle, ConnectorPageSinkId) - Method in class io.trino.plugin.blackhole.BlackHolePageSinkProvider
 
createPageSink(ConnectorTransactionHandle, ConnectorSession, ConnectorOutputTableHandle, ConnectorPageSinkId) - Method in class io.trino.plugin.blackhole.BlackHolePageSinkProvider
 
createPageSource(ConnectorTransactionHandle, ConnectorSession, ConnectorSplit, ConnectorTableHandle, List<ColumnHandle>, DynamicFilter) - Method in class io.trino.plugin.blackhole.BlackHolePageSourceProvider
 
createSchema(ConnectorSession, String, Map<String, Object>, TrinoPrincipal)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
createTable(ConnectorSession, ConnectorTableMetadata, boolean)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
createView(ConnectorSession, SchemaTableName, ConnectorViewDefinition, boolean)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 

D

DISTRIBUTED_ON - Static variable in class io.trino.plugin.blackhole.BlackHoleConnector
 
dropTable(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
dropView(ConnectorSession, SchemaTableName)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 

E

equals(Object) - Method in class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
equals(Object) -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 

F

FIELD_LENGTH_PROPERTY - Static variable in class io.trino.plugin.blackhole.BlackHoleConnector
 
finish() - Method in class io.trino.plugin.blackhole.BlackHoleMergeSink
 
finishCreateTable(ConnectorSession, ConnectorOutputTableHandle, Collection<Slice>, Collection<ComputedStatistics>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
finishInsert(ConnectorSession, ConnectorInsertTableHandle, Collection<Slice>, Collection<ComputedStatistics>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
finishMerge(ConnectorSession, ConnectorMergeTableHandle, Collection<Slice>, Collection<ComputedStatistics>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
finishStatisticsCollection(ConnectorSession, ConnectorTableHandle, Collection<ComputedStatistics>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 

G

getAddresses() - Method in enum class io.trino.plugin.blackhole.BlackHoleSplit
 
getBucketFunction(ConnectorTransactionHandle, ConnectorSession, ConnectorPartitioningHandle, List<Type>, int) - Method in class io.trino.plugin.blackhole.BlackHoleNodePartitioningProvider
 
getColumnHandles()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getColumnHandles(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getColumnMetadata(ConnectorSession, ConnectorTableHandle, ColumnH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getColumnType() - Method in class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
getConnectorFactories() - Method in class io.trino.plugin.blackhole.BlackHolePlugin
 
getFieldsLength()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getInfo() - Method in enum class io.trino.plugin.blackhole.BlackHoleSplit
 
getMergeRowIdColumnHandle(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getMetadata(ConnectorSession, ConnectorTransactionHandle) -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
getName() - Method in class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
getName() - Method in class io.trino.plugin.blackhole.BlackHoleConnectorFactory
 
getNewTableLayout(ConnectorSession, ConnectorTableMetadata)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getNodePartitioningProvider() -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
getPageProcessingDelay() - Method in class io.trino.plugin.blackhole.BlackHoleInsertTableHandle
 
getPageProcessingDelay() - Method in class io.trino.plugin.blackhole.BlackHoleOutputTableHandle
 
getPageProcessingDelay()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getPageSinkProvider() -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
getPageSourceProvider() -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
getPagesPerSplit()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getRetainedSizeInBytes() - Method in enum class io.trino.plugin.blackhole.BlackHoleSplit
 
getRowChangeParadigm(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getRowsPerPage()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getSchemaName()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getSplitCount()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getSplitManager() -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
getSplits(ConnectorTransactionHandle, ConnectorSession, ConnectorTableHandle, DynamicFilter, Constraint) - Method in class io.trino.plugin.blackhole.BlackHoleSplitManager
 
getStatisticsCollectionMetadata(ConnectorSession, ConnectorTableHandle, Map<String, Object>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getTable() - Method in class io.trino.plugin.blackhole.BlackHoleOutputTableHandle
 
getTableHandle() - Method in class io.trino.plugin.blackhole.BlackHoleMergeTableHandle
 
getTableHandle(ConnectorSession, SchemaTableName)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getTableMetadata(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getTableName()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
getTableProperties() -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
getTableStatistics(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getView(ConnectorSession, SchemaTableName)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
getViews(ConnectorSession, Optional<String>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 

H

hashCode() - Method in class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
hashCode()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 

I

INSTANCE - Enum constant in enum class io.trino.plugin.blackhole.BlackHolePartitioningHandle
 
INSTANCE - Enum constant in enum class io.trino.plugin.blackhole.BlackHoleSplit
 
INSTANCE - Enum constant in enum class io.trino.plugin.blackhole.BlackHoleTransactionHandle
 
io.trino.plugin.blackhole - package io.trino.plugin.blackhole
 
isNumericType(Type) - Static method in class io.trino.plugin.blackhole.BlackHolePageSourceProvider
 
isRemotelyAccessible() - Method in enum class io.trino.plugin.blackhole.BlackHoleSplit
 

L

listSchemaNames(ConnectorSession)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
listTableColumns(ConnectorSession, SchemaTablePrefix)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
listTables(ConnectorSession, Optional<String>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
listViews(ConnectorSession, Optional<String>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 

P

PAGE_PROCESSING_DELAY - Static variable in class io.trino.plugin.blackhole.BlackHoleConnector
 
PAGES_PER_SPLIT_PROPERTY - Static variable in class io.trino.plugin.blackhole.BlackHoleConnector
 

R

renameTable(ConnectorSession, ConnectorTableHandle, SchemaTableName)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
ROWS_PER_PAGE_PROPERTY - Static variable in class io.trino.plugin.blackhole.BlackHoleConnector
 

S

setColumnType(ConnectorSession, ConnectorTableHandle, ColumnHandle, Type)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
setViewColumnComment(ConnectorSession, SchemaTableName, String, Optional<String>)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 
shutdown() - Method in class io.trino.plugin.blackhole.BlackHoleConnector
 
SPLIT_COUNT_PROPERTY - Static variable in class io.trino.plugin.blackhole.BlackHoleConnector
 
storeMergedRows(Page) - Method in class io.trino.plugin.blackhole.BlackHoleMergeSink
 
streamTableColumns(ConnectorSession, SchemaTablePrefix)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 

T

toColumnMetadata() - Method in class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
toSchemaTableName()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
toString() - Method in class io.trino.plugin.blackhole.BlackHoleColumnHandle
 
toString()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
toTableMetadata() - Method in class io.trino.plugin.blackhole.BlackHoleTableHandle
 
truncateTable(ConnectorSession, ConnectorTableHandle) - Method in class io.trino.plugin.blackhole.BlackHoleMetadata
 

V

valueOf(String) - Static method in enum class io.trino.plugin.blackhole.BlackHolePartitioningHandle
Returns the enum constant of this class with the specified name.
valueOf(String) - Static method in enum class io.trino.plugin.blackhole.BlackHoleSplit
Returns the enum constant of this class with the specified name.
valueOf(String) - Static method in enum class io.trino.plugin.blackhole.BlackHoleTransactionHandle
Returns the enum constant of this class with the specified name.
values() - Static method in enum class io.trino.plugin.blackhole.BlackHolePartitioningHandle
Returns an array containing the constants of this enum class, in the order they are declared.
values() - Static method in enum class io.trino.plugin.blackhole.BlackHoleSplit
Returns an array containing the constants of this enum class, in the order they are declared.
values() - Static method in enum class io.trino.plugin.blackhole.BlackHoleTransactionHandle
Returns an array containing the constants of this enum class, in the order they are declared.
B C D E F G H I L P R S T V 
All Classes and Interfaces|All Packages|Constant Field Values